![]() |
ציטוט:
הקטע הכי "מסובך" זה לחפש את כלים של ה IIS בשביל לגרום לו לפתוח חשבון, למחוק חשבון, ולהגידר לו נתונים, וכמובן, לאבטח הכל ולבנות ממש ידידותי (אולי צריך גם התממשקות מול תוכנות נוספות, שזה יכול להיות קשה, אבל החלק העיקרי קל). ליצור תיקייה זה ממש פשוט. השתמשתי, בעבר, במשהו שבניתי שהכיל חלק קטן (מאד) של העניין הזה (רק אתרי FTP). להרחיב את זה ל WEB, כרוך בעבודת מחקר קצרה. אמנם, זה בלי הגרפיקה והנוחות של הפאנלים הגדולים, אבל אפשר בהחלט לבנות דברים כאלה, רק צריך לשים (מאד) לב לאבטחה, שבזה מתמקד רוב הפיתוח של הפאנלים שבהם הרוב משתמשים, והתממשקות לתוכנות אחרות. רק בשביל שתבינו כמה זה לא מאד מסובך- ל IIS יש אפשרות ניהול משורת הפקודה, שלמעשה מסתמכת על הרצת כמה סקריפטים שלו שעושה פעולות קבועות. לא כזה עניין גדול לעשות קוד שישתמש ויריץ את אותן פקודות, כתגובה למשהו שהלקוח עשה. למשל, אם אני אריץ דרך קוד את הקובץ הזה Iisftp.vbs מספריית הסקריפטים של IIS, ואעביר אליו פרמטרים, אני אוכל ליצור אתר FTP, בקלי קלות. רק באמצעות הרצת כל מיני קבצי סקריפטים, ולהעביר אליהם פרמטרים כפי שהלקוח הכניס. קודם, כמובן, יוצרים תיקייה, ואז משתמשים ב Syntax של הסקריפט הזה (שנמצא ב System32) בשביל להגדיר את התיקייה כאתר FTP. קיימים עוד הרבה סקריפטים כאלה, בשביל להגדיר אפליקציית אינטרנט, הרשאות אליה, הרשאות WEB של קובץ מסויים, וכל מה שצריך. באותה דרך אפשר להשתמש ב Iisvdir.vbs בשביל להגדיר תיקייה כ Virtual Directory, ולעשות עוד הרבה מאד פעולות באמצעות קבצי סקריפטים שונים, שרק צריך לדעת להריץ אותם עם הפרמטרים הנכונים. זה, אמנם, דורש לתת לקוד הרצת הרשאה מלאה, ואפשרות להשתמש מדי פעם בהרשאות קצת מורחבות, אבל באמצעות אבטחה מתאימה זה לא בעייה. אני בטוח שהרבה מתכנתים יוכלו לעשות את זה, אם ילמדו קצת. בטח מתכנתים כמו אלעד, שגם מבינים מצויין בתחזוק רשתות (ונראה לי שגם בעבודה עם IIS). |
http://img117.imageshack.us/img117/4154/conn4mx.gif
שלחתי גם אימייל עם תמונה באיכות יותר טובה. לא הצלחתי להתרשם מתפקוד המערכת בגלל הבאגים שנוצרו לי בהתנה של EASYPHP (שרץ עם PHP 4.3.1). תנסה לתקן את זה. מההתרשמות החיצונית זאת אחלה מערכת. נ.ב אני יכול לעזור לך בתיקון הבאגים, כי אני כבר מנוסה בתיקון הבאגים האלה כי אני עובד הרבה עם EASYPHP. |
מערכת מעולה,
כל הכבוד תומר ! |
ציטוט:
בינתיים, תערוך את php.ini ותשנה שם את הברירת מחדל של error_reporting שלא יציג Notices |
בהצלחה תומר,מערכת ממש נחמדה.
|
פסדר, אבל בכל זאת, לא כדאי למנוע את השגיאות האלה וזהו?
(זה באמת דברים מטומטמים.. כמו למשל: PHP קוד:
PHP קוד:
|
ציטוט:
לא הקפדתי על זה בגלל שהרוב משתמשים ב DA והקובץ הגדרות שם הוא הצגת FATAL ERRORS בלבד |
כל הכבוד על היוזמה
|
אני עוד ימצא דלת אחורית במערכת, חכה חכה תומר אני לא ישכח איך הרסת לי את החברה.
חחחחחחחחחחחח סתם.. תיהיה בריא, תודה רבה. |
נמצאו כמה באגים (בסטטיסטיקות למשל) וזה יטופל בקרוב. אתם תעודכנו על זה.
|
כל הזמנים הם GMT +2. הזמן כעת הוא 00:36. |
מופעל באמצעות VBulletin גרסה 3.8.6
כל הזכויות שמורות ©
כל הזכויות שמורות לסולל יבוא ורשתות (1997) בע"מ